One of the first challenges new learners face when embarking on their Japanese language journey is mastering the three writing systems: Hiragana, Katakana, and Kanji. Hiragana and Katakana are phonetic alphabets used for native Japanese words and foreign loanwords, respectively. Kanji, on the other hand, consists of Chinese characters representing meaning and can be daunting due to the sheer number of characters to memorize.

Beyond the writing systems, Japanese grammar also poses its own set of challenges. Sentence structure, verb conjugations, and honorific language are essential aspects to grasp to effectively communicate in Japanese. Politeness levels in Japanese vary depending on the formality of the situation, adding layers of complexity to conversations.

Immersing oneself in Japanese culture through literature, films, and music can significantly enhance language learning. Japanese media exposes learners to colloquial expressions, cultural references, and real-life contexts that textbooks may not cover. Additionally, interacting with native speakers or joining language exchange programs can provide valuable practical experience and insights into the language.
